What Are Paper Stocks in India?

Under the radar paper stocks in India are shares of companies that manufacture writing paper, newsprint, kraft paper, tissue and specialty paper. The Indian paper industry serves education, packaging, newspapers and specialty industrial applications, with several mid-sized paper mills offering low PE ratios and consistent dividend yields.

How to Evaluate Paper Stocks in India

  • Check PE ratio versus the sector average for under the radar paper stocks in India; a PE discount may indicate value if earnings are stable
  • Target ROE above 12% consistently over 3 years to confirm management quality in under the radar paper stocks in India
  • Verify debt-to-equity is manageable; for most under the radar paper stocks in India a D/E below 1 is preferred
  • Review dividend yield track record as a signal of free cash flow discipline
  • Cross-check the latest quarterly results to ensure the fundamentals of under the radar paper stocks in India are improving, not deteriorating

Risks of Investing in Paper Stocks

  • Liquidity risk: Some under the radar paper stocks in India have lower trading volumes which can lead to wider bid-ask spreads and price impact on entry or exit.
  • Sector cyclicality: Paper sector earnings can swing significantly with raw material costs, demand cycles or policy changes.
  • Information gap: Lower analyst coverage for under the radar paper stocks in India means investors must rely more on primary research and company filings.
  • Concentration risk: Several under the radar paper stocks in India have significant revenue concentration in a single product, customer or geography.
  • Promoter holding risk: High promoter ownership in some under the radar paper stocks in India can mean limited free float and potential governance concerns.

Is Andhra Paper a good value stock?

Ans. Andhra Paper Ltd is a fully integrated paper manufacturer with captive pulp and power facilities in Andhra Pradesh. Its low PE relative to cash flow and consistent dividend make it a value-oriented pick within the paper sector. Verify current financials before investing.

What does Seshasayee Paper make?

Ans. Seshasayee Paper and Boards manufactures writing, printing and copier paper from wood pulp and agricultural residues. It is based in Tamil Nadu and exports a portion of its production to Southeast Asia.

What is Satia Industries?

Ans. Satia Industries is a Punjab-based paper manufacturer that produces agri-residue-based writing and printing paper. Its use of paddy straw as raw material provides cost advantages and addresses stubble burning simultaneously.
